    Why is the display off on my Denon Stereo Receiver?
    • M
      Melissa AtkinsonSep 10, 2025
      If the display on your Denon Stereo Receiver is off: * Check the “Dimmer” setting and ensure it's not set to “OFF”. * Ensure that the PURE DIRECT mode is not enabled. Select a surround mode other than PURE DIRECT.

    Why is my Denon Stereo Receiver subwoofer not producing sound?
    • G
      Gregory RamirezAug 23, 2025
      If there's no sound from your subwoofer connected to the Denon Stereo Receiver, check these: * Ensure the subwoofer is powered on. * Verify the “Subwoofer” setting in “Speaker Configuration” is set to “Yes”. * Check the subwoofer connections. * Adjust the subwoofer's volume to an audible level.

    Why is there no sound from HDMI monitor on my Denon Stereo Receiver?
    • M
      Mark BlairAug 25, 2025
      If you're not getting sound from the monitor connected via HDMI to your Denon Stereo Receiver, the “Manual Setup” – “HDMI Setup” – “HDMI Audio Out” setting might be set to “AMP”. Change it to “TV”.

    Why is DTS sound not working on my Denon Stereo Receiver?
    • J
      Janet PittsAug 26, 2025
      If DTS sound isn't being output from your Denon Stereo Receiver, consider these possibilities: * The Blu-ray Disc player / DVD player’s audio output setting isn't set to bitstream. * The Blu-ray Disc player / DVD player isn't compatible with DTS sound playback. * The receiver’s “Decode Mode” setting is set to “PCM”. To fix this: * Set the Blu-ray Disc player / DVD player. Refer to its operating instructions for details. * Use a DTS-compatible player. * Set the receiver to “Auto” or “DTS” mode.

    Why is there no sound from the center speaker on my Denon Stereo Receiver?
    • J
      Julie RodriguezAug 28, 2025
      If no sound is coming from the center speaker on your Denon Stereo Receiver, and you're playing a monaural source (like TV or AM radio) in “STANDARD” (Dolby/ DTS Surround) mode, try setting the mode to something other than “STANDARD” (Dolby/ DTS Surround).

    Why is there no sound from surround speakers on my Denon Stereo Receiver?
    • E
      Ellen TaylorAug 29, 2025
      If you're not getting any sound from the surround speakers connected to your Denon Stereo Receiver, it might be because the surround mode is set to “STEREO”, “DIRECT” or “PURE DIRECT”. Try setting it to a surround playback mode.

    How to output HDMI audio signals from speakers on Denon Stereo Receiver?
    • J
      Jeffrey PerezSep 12, 2025
      If HDMI audio signals aren't being output from the speakers connected to your Denon Stereo Receiver, check that the “Manual Setup” – “HDMI Setup” – “HDMI Audio Out” setting is set to “AMP” and not “TV”.
